引言
随着人工智能(AI)技术的飞速发展,AI应用开发已成为推动社会进步的重要力量。本文将深入解析AI应用开发的实战案例,帮助读者了解AI技术的实际应用,并展望智能未来的发展趋势。
一、AI应用开发概述
1.1 AI应用开发定义
AI应用开发是指利用人工智能技术,结合实际业务需求,开发出能够模拟、延伸和扩展人类智能的应用程序的过程。
1.2 AI应用开发流程
- 需求分析:明确应用目标、功能、性能等需求。
- 数据准备:收集、清洗、标注数据,为模型训练提供数据基础。
- 模型选择:根据需求选择合适的AI模型,如神经网络、决策树等。
- 模型训练:使用准备好的数据对模型进行训练,优化模型性能。
- 模型评估:对训练好的模型进行评估,确保其满足需求。
- 部署上线:将模型部署到实际应用场景中,实现智能化功能。
二、实战案例解析
2.1 案例一:智能客服系统
2.1.1 案例背景
某电商企业希望开发一款智能客服系统,以提升客户服务质量和效率。
2.1.2 案例解析
- 需求分析:实现常见问题的自动回答、智能推荐、客户情绪分析等功能。
- 数据准备:收集用户咨询数据,进行数据清洗和标注。
- 模型选择:采用基于自然语言处理(NLP)的循环神经网络(RNN)模型。
- 模型训练:使用标注数据进行模型训练,优化模型性能。
- 模型评估:通过实际对话数据评估模型效果,调整模型参数。
- 部署上线:将模型部署到企业内部服务器,实现智能客服功能。
2.2 案例二:自动驾驶系统
2.2.1 案例背景
随着新能源汽车的普及,自动驾驶技术成为汽车行业的热点。
2.2.2 案例解析
- 需求分析:实现车辆在复杂道路环境下的自动驾驶功能。
- 数据准备:收集大量道路行驶数据,包括路况、车辆行驶轨迹等。
- 模型选择:采用基于深度学习的卷积神经网络(CNN)模型,用于图像识别。
- 模型训练:使用收集到的数据对模型进行训练,优化模型性能。
- 模型评估:在封闭测试场和实际道路进行测试,评估模型效果。
- 部署上线:将模型部署到自动驾驶车辆中,实现自动驾驶功能。
三、智能未来展望
随着AI技术的不断进步,未来将出现更多智能应用,如智能医疗、智能教育、智能城市等。以下是一些展望:
- 个性化服务:AI技术将使服务更加个性化,满足用户个性化需求。
- 高效决策:AI技术将帮助企业和政府做出更加高效、准确的决策。
- 智能化生活:智能家居、智能穿戴设备等将使人们的生活更加便捷、舒适。
- 可持续发展:AI技术将在环境保护、资源优化等方面发挥重要作用。
结语
AI应用开发是推动社会进步的重要力量,通过实战案例解析,我们可以更好地了解AI技术的实际应用,并为未来智能发展做好准备。
